Transaction d71ea949efbf51e0b06316952d755b96644db1ecff1ad551acd247114835c50a

1 Input
2 Outputs
  • d71ea949efbf51e0b06316952d755b96644db1ecff1ad551acd247114835c50a:0
  • value  13798363176
    address  3G44UXa93P7s3MGGhq4NTy1e2GLNhWGuv1
  • d71ea949efbf51e0b06316952d755b96644db1ecff1ad551acd247114835c50a:1
  • value  2299992955
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w